When you consider how this tourmaline reflects light, imagine a softer, more intimate glow in comparison to the high, crystalline brilliance of sapphires and rubies, which flash with higher refractive intensity. Tourmaline has a refractive character in the range of 1.624 to 1.644, which translates into a gentler, enveloping brilliance and a warm inner depth rather than the white fire and intense dispersion that characterize corundums. Compared to morganite, which shares a rosy palette, this purplish pink tourmaline offers stronger saturation and a livelier scintillation due to its mixed brilliant cut, while its pleochroic nature allows the gem to reveal different notes of color as it moves, like a heart that changes with every glance.
